THE DEFINITION 
Adverbs are words that modify: 
• a verb ( He drives slowly ) 
• an adjective ( David is extremely clever) 
• another adverb ( She moved very slowly down the aisle ) 
• a whole sentence ( Luckily, the car stopped in time ) 
Adverbs often tell when , where , why , how or how much 
something happens or happened.

Many adverbs are formed by adding –ly to an adjective 
Adjective slow beautiful quiet easy specific 
Adverb slowly beautifully quietly easily specifically 
Note : 
There are some adjectives also end in –ly, including costly, 
manly, deadly, friendly, lively, and timely. 
These are not 
adverbs

Position of adverbs : 
Adverb of manner : 
- It comes after the verb or at the end of the sentence. 
She sneaks quietly out of the house. 
Their teacher speaks quietly. 
Adverb of time : 
- It usually comes at the end of the sentence. 
I will tell you the story tomorrow. 
- But if you want to put more emphasis, you should put it at the 
beginning of the sentence. 
Tomorrow, I will tell you the story . 
• Adverb of place : 
- It comes after the object. 
I didn’t see him here. 
- If there is no object, it comes after the main verb. 
He stayed behind.
Adverb of degree : 
- It comes before what it modifies. 
The exam was so difficult . 
It was too hot. 
Adverb of frequency : 
- It comes before the main verb. 
I always get up at 6:00. 
- Or between the auxiliary and the main verb. 
He doesn’t always play tennis. 
Mandy can usually play football on Sundays. 
- Or after the verb to be. 
Susan is never late. 
Note: The adverbs often, usually, sometimes and occasionally can also 
go at the beginning of the sentence. 
Sometimes, I go swimming. 
-The adverbs rarely and seldom can go at the end of a sentence. 
He eats fish very seldom .
